Title: Wilbur L McCoy: Innovator in Glass Machinery and Vehicle Technology

Introduction

Wilbur L McCoy is a notable inventor based in Toledo, OH (US). He has made significant contributions to the fields of glass machinery and vehicle technology. With a total of 3 patents to his name, McCoy's innovations have had a lasting impact on the industries he has worked in.

Latest Patents

One of McCoy's latest patents is the "Shear blade lockout in an individual section glass machine." This invention features an electronics package that automatically inhibits the operation of shear blades in a glass machine. It responds to periodic signals from an encoder disc and motion detectors to ensure safe operation. The system includes a programmable counter and a watchdog timer, which work together to prevent shear activation when necessary. Another significant patent is the "Multifunction steering wheel," which allows for the control of various vehicle functions such as headlights and windshield wipers. This invention utilizes a transmitter-receiver pair to communicate between the steering wheel and the stationary steering column, enhancing driver convenience and safety.
